linux系統(tǒng)遠(yuǎn)程關(guān)機(jī)之后能遠(yuǎn)程喚醒。
10年積累的成都做網(wǎng)站、成都網(wǎng)站建設(shè)經(jīng)驗(yàn),可以快速應(yīng)對(duì)客戶對(duì)網(wǎng)站的新想法和需求。提供各種問(wèn)題對(duì)應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識(shí)你,你也不認(rèn)識(shí)我。但先網(wǎng)站制作后付款的網(wǎng)站建設(shè)流程,更有龍崗免費(fèi)網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
1、連接上相應(yīng)的linux主機(jī),進(jìn)入到等待輸入shell指令的linux命令行狀態(tài)下。
2、以重啟為例,在linux命令行中輸入:boot。
3、回車(chē)鍵執(zhí)行shell指令,此時(shí)會(huì)看到linux主機(jī)成功重啟了。
;?????linux如何進(jìn)入命令行?我們一起來(lái)了解一下吧。
1、打開(kāi)linux系統(tǒng),在linux的桌面的空白處右擊,在彈出的下拉選項(xiàng)里,點(diǎn)擊打開(kāi)終端即可進(jìn)入命令行。
2、在Linux的首頁(yè)使用Ctrl+alt+T,打開(kāi)終端。
Linux支持多終端,可以再使用Ctrl+alt+T命令打開(kāi)多個(gè)終端。
3、通過(guò)“searchyourcomputer”功能搜索,terminal,也可以打開(kāi)。
本文章基于ThinkpadE15品牌、centos7系統(tǒng)撰寫(xiě)的。
命令運(yùn)行時(shí)使用CTRL+Z,強(qiáng)制當(dāng)前進(jìn)程轉(zhuǎn)為后臺(tái),并使之掛起(暫停).
1. 使進(jìn)程恢復(fù)運(yùn)行(后臺(tái))
(1)使用命令bg
Example:
zuii@zuii-desktop:~/unp/tcpcliserv$ ./tcpserv01
*這里使用CTRL+Z,此時(shí)serv01是停止?fàn)顟B(tài)*
[1]+ Stopped ./tcpserv01
zuii@zuii-desktop:~/unp/tcpcliserv$ bg
[1]+ ./tcpserv01 *此時(shí)serv01運(yùn)行在后臺(tái)*
zuii@zuii-desktop:~/unp/tcpcliserv$
(2)如果用CTRL+Z停止了幾個(gè)程序呢?
Example:
zuii@zuii-desktop:~/unp/tcpcliserv$ jobs
[1]- Running ./tcpserv01
[2]+ Stopped ./tcpcli01 127.0.0.1
zuii@zuii-desktop:~/unp/tcpcliserv$ bg %1
bash: bg:任務(wù) 1 已轉(zhuǎn)入后臺(tái) *后臺(tái)運(yùn)行*
2. 使進(jìn)程恢復(fù)至前臺(tái)運(yùn)行
Example:
zuii@zuii-desktop:~/unp/tcpcliserv$ ./tcpserv04
[1]+ Stopped ./tcpserv04
zuii@zuii-desktop:~/unp/tcpcliserv$ fg
./tcpserv04
總結(jié):
(1) CTRL+Z掛起進(jìn)程并放入后臺(tái)
(2) jobs 顯示當(dāng)前暫停的進(jìn)程
(3) bg %N 使第N個(gè)任務(wù)在后臺(tái)運(yùn)行(%前有空格)
(4) fg %N 使第N個(gè)任務(wù)在前臺(tái)運(yùn)行
默認(rèn)bg,fg不帶%N時(shí)表示對(duì)最后一個(gè)進(jìn)程操作!
最近研究命令行下,遠(yuǎn)程喚醒(Wake On LAN)家里的windows臺(tái)式機(jī)。
linux下可以用 etherwake 這個(gè)軟件,發(fā)送魔術(shù)封包(Magic Packet)遠(yuǎn)程喚醒機(jī)器。
我用的是樹(shù)莓派,記錄一下遠(yuǎn)程喚醒的方法。
首先安裝 etherwake (基于Debian / Ubuntu )
安裝完成后,可以用下面的命令遠(yuǎn)程喚醒
或者(下面兩個(gè)命令我沒(méi)有親自嘗試過(guò))
比如你的MAC地址是 AA:BB:CC:DD:EE:FF ,就可以用
發(fā)送魔術(shù)封包喚醒遠(yuǎn)程機(jī)器。
其實(shí)還有其他一些細(xì)節(jié),以后有機(jī)會(huì)慢慢補(bǔ)充吧。
參考文章:
[1] HowTo: Wake Up Computers Using Linux Command [ Wake-on-LAN ( WOL ) ]
;?????linux如何進(jìn)入命令行呢,下面就讓我們來(lái)看看吧。
1、打開(kāi)linux系統(tǒng),在linux的桌面的空白處右擊。
2、在彈出的下拉選項(xiàng)里,點(diǎn)擊打開(kāi)終端即可進(jìn)入命令行。
3、按快捷鍵Ctrl+Alt+T/Ctrl+Alt+F1-F6也可以打開(kāi)終端窗口進(jìn)入命令行。
4、也可以直接搜索終端。
以上就是的分享,希望能幫助到大家。
本文章基于ThinkpadE15品牌、centos7系統(tǒng)撰寫(xiě)的。
sleep命令?
常用工具命令 sleep命令暫停指定的時(shí)間。?
語(yǔ)法?
sleep(參數(shù))?
參數(shù)?
時(shí)間:指定要暫停時(shí)間的長(zhǎng)度。?
時(shí)間長(zhǎng)度,后面可接 s、m、h 或 d,其中 s 為秒,m 為 分鐘,h 為小時(shí),d 為日數(shù)。 實(shí)例 有時(shí)在寫(xiě)一些以循環(huán)方式運(yùn)行的監(jiān)控腳本,設(shè)置時(shí)間間隔是必不可少的,下面是一個(gè)Shell進(jìn)度條的腳本演示在腳本中生成延時(shí)。?
#!/bin/bash?
b='' for ((i=0;$i=100;i++)) do printf "Progress:[%-100s]%d%%\r" $b $i sleep 0.1 b=#$b done